The Epson Adjustment Tool is a utility designed to help users perform printer maintenance and troubleshoot common issues. It provides a range of functions that are typically available only to technicians. Some of the key features of the Epson Adjustment Tool include:
Resetting the Ink Pad Counter – If you get an error indicating that the waste ink pad is full, the Epson Adjustment Tool can reset the ink pad counter, allowing you to continue printing.
Cleaning the Printhead – Over time, printheads can get clogged, leading to poor print quality. The tool helps clean the printhead to ensure that ink flows smoothly.
Aligning the Printhead – Misalignment of the printhead can lead to blurry or off-center prints. The tool allows you to align the printhead for better print quality.
Resetting the Waste Ink Pad – The tool can reset the counter for the waste ink pad, which helps you clear errors related to the waste ink pad.
Other Maintenance Tasks – The Adjustment Tool also provides options to check ink levels, adjust carriage movements, and perform various other maintenance tasks.
While it is designed for use by service professionals, the Epson Adjustment Tool can be downloaded and used by individuals who need to perform printer maintenance on their own.
The Epson printer typically stops functioning when the waste ink pad becomes full. This is a safety feature that prevents ink overflow. The Epson Adjustment Tool can reset the ink pad counter, allowing you to continue using the printer without replacing the waste ink pad immediately.
